In 2023, the play is being performed Off-Broadway by Red Bull Theater in a new adaptation by Jeffrey Hatcher and Kathryn Walat, directed by Jesse Berger. Arden of Faversham was first published anonymously by Edward White in 1592, and has been associated with the Shakespeare canon since the late eighteenth century. For most of three centuries, it was performed in George Lillo's adaptation; the original was brought back to the stage in 1921, and has received intermittent revivals since. It is also notable in that it creates a tragedy from the lives of ordinary people (conventionally the stuff of comedy), and so stands as an early example of a domestic tragedy. The play itself is printed in black letter, which is in keeping with the moral tone of the title page, and Martin Wiggins has suggested that the play may have been intended for reading rather than performance (Wiggins 285-7). Arden would be seen by an Elizabethan viewer as relinquishing appropriate control of his household thereby committing a disloyalty to the conventional notion of masculine status and undermining social parameters. Another candidate, favored by critics F. G. Fleay, Charles Crawford, H. Dugdale Sykes, and Brian Vickers, is Thomas Kyd, who at one time shared rooms with Marlowe.
